The 28-year-old Vargas (16-0, 14 knockouts), who lives and trains in Las Vegas, last fought on Dec. 14, 2024, defeating Jesus Gonzalez by technical decision in the fifth round. The fight also took place at Thunder Studios. The decision snapped a string of three consecutive knockout wins for Vargas.

The southpaw Vargas is the oldest of three sons of former two-time world junior middleweight champion and 1996 Channel Islands High School graduate Fernando Vargas. All three siblings are unbeaten in the pro ranks and are trained by their father.

Junior welterweight Emiliano Vargas fought on May 4 at the T-Mobile Arena in his hometown of Las Vegas, dropping Spain’s Juan Leon twice en route to a second-round knockout win.

Emiliano, who was born in Oxnard, improved to 14-0, 12 KOs. The 21-year-old, who is promoted by Bob Arum, will reportedly return to the ring in July.

Amado Vargas, who fights at 135 pounds, also scored a knockout win in his last fight on April 26. The 24-year-old stopped journeyman Angel Luna in the third round, improving to 13-0, 6 KOs. Fernando Jr. and Amado are promoted by Marv Rodriguez.

Gaston Coria (23-7, 9 KOs), who is originally from Villa Mercedes, Argentina, and now lives in Los Angeles, also fought on the Dec. 15 card, knocking out unbeaten Raul Lizarraga in the seventh round. The 28-year-old has won five or his last seven fights.
